Output 305a8eb3de4e5fa23a91faf190cb9ddca6c8a8a2861387765ae00ea2d8a92afe:0

value
308100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943a98135a92a2673e0d7912941bb5136cd1633c OP_EQUAL
address
3FCn87vw4xPZzaxqPnK9tUEN63bvQas5PB
transaction
305a8eb3de4e5fa23a91faf190cb9ddca6c8a8a2861387765ae00ea2d8a92afe
confirmations
266931
spent
true